directions

  • In a large bowl mix together flour and salt.
  • Slowly stir in the warm water and mix until a stiff dough is formed.
  • Lightly flour your counter top or board and turn out dough.
  • Knead for 10 minutes, adding a touch of water if the dough is too stiff to work with.
  • Form into a ball, cover and let rest for 20 minutes.
  • At this point you can roll it out and cut into desired shapes or run through a pasta machine.
  • Boil a large pot of salted water, drop in pasta and cook for 4 minutes, drain and serve.

  1. Made this 17/5-05 and it turned out really good. I was so impressed with how easy the dough was to work with! I did add about 1/4 cup more water - maybe the semolina here is dryer. But when I made spaghetti out of it, it took only a couple of minutes for it all to stick together. Next time, I will make tagliatelle! Taste was super!!!
